As regulatory demands tighten across Europe, understanding and implementing the EN 17255 standard is essential for anyone involved in continuous emissions monitoring and data acquisition.

Join experts Antony Sumner and David McGee for a practical and insightful webinar breaking down EN 17255.

Together, they’ll explore what the standard means in real-world settings. They'll share their experiences in helping industries ensure compliance through robust data handling and reporting.

Key takeaways

- Understanding EN 17255 – gain a clear overview of the standard’s key principles, structure, and requirements for CEMS and DAHS

- Achieving compliance – learn practical strategies for aligning your data systems with EN 17255 to ensure traceability, accuracy, and reporting integrity

- Best practices from the field – hear tips from leading experts with decades of experience delivering compliant emissions monitoring solutions.

Whether you're an environmental manager, emissions engineer, or compliance specialist, this webinar is your opportunity to deepen your understanding of EN 17255 and improve your organisation’s approach to environmental data management.

Antony Sumner

Antony currently works as an 'Application Specialist' for Gasmet Technologies Oy, specialising in the design and provision of industrial air emissions solutions, including CEMS and DAHs utilised in the regulatory, research and process control markets. Antony has over 25 years’ experience in the world of industrial emissions monitoring, working as both an end user and provider of CEMS equipment and software solutions for projects all over the world. An active member within the Source Testing Association (STA) for many years, Antony currently has the shared role of ‘Equipment Suppliers Officer’ for 25/26 within the STA.

David Mcgee

David McGee is Northern Europe Business Development Manager at ENVEA, a global leader in emissions monitoring and environmental data systems. Since 2023, he has worked with industrial clients to implement compliant solutions aligned with standards such as EN 17255. ENVEA’s advanced CEMS and DAHS technologies support accurate reporting, traceability, and regulatory compliance. With prior experience in similar roles across the environmental monitoring sector, David focuses on bridging technical requirements with practical implementation, particularly in emissions-intensive industries adapting to tightening European regulations.
